Stud Muffin Supreme Flaunts His BEST Dance Moves!

Stud Muffin Supreme gets the crowd going with his viral dance moves! The dancer performs to “Pump Up The Jam” by Technotronic.

Leave a Reply

Your email address will not be published. Required fields are marked *